TBB 122 is a popular farm-to-table restaurant known for its outstanding food and friendly service. The menu features a variety of dishes, including an impressive brunch selection and a good selection of baked goods and specialty coffee. The restaurant has a cozy atmosphere and a beautiful patio located in a charming spot in downtown Alpharetta. While parking can be limited, the relaxing vibe and high-quality ingredients encourage customers to return. Guests often enjoy dishes like the shakshuka, short rib, and roasted chicken, and can also choose from a good wine selection, such as Sancerre by the bottle. However, recent reviews highlight that service can be slow and sometimes unprofessional, with long waits to order and get the check. Despite this, the food remains excellent, and the ambiance continues to attract diners for breakfast, brunch, and dinner. Overall, TBB 122 is a well-loved spot for those seeking a great meal in a cozy setting.
